草庐IT

Accounts

全部标签

android - token 不是来自此身份池的受支持提供商 Amazon Mobile Hub Android

当我点击Google登录时,我使用以下代码在onActivityResult方法中获取token:GoogleSignInAccountaccount=result.getSignInAccount();Stringtoken=account.getIdToken();credentialsProvider=newCognitoCachingCredentialsProvider(Login.this,//Context"MyPoolID",//IdentityPoolIDRegions.US_EAST_1//Region);我已使用管理联合身份在Cognito中添加了Google客户

android - Android中如何实现webview的多登录?

我想制作一个应用程序,允许用户使用不同的webview登录同一站点的多个帐户。比如我有2个WebView。每个WebView将加载相同的站点,例如gmail.com。并且用户可以在单独的WebView中使用单独的帐户登录。但我面临的问题是2个WebView总是登录到同一个帐户。我用谷歌搜索了很多,这里有一些相关的标题,FacebookMultiLogininAndroidWebviewUsingWebViewformulti-pagelogintowebsiteandfetchdataMultipleLog-InsonSeparateWebViews?(Android)但仍未找到可接受

Android:AccountManager.getAccounts() 返回一个空数组

我正在编写一个针对Lollipop及更高版本的应用程序。这是我的第一个Android应用。我正在尝试获取与该设备关联的所有帐户的列表。这是我的代码:publicvoidgetAllContactsAccounts(Contextcontext){AccountManageraccountManager=(AccountManager)context.getSystemService(Context.ACCOUNT_SERVICE);Account[]accounts=accountManager.getAccounts();System.out.println("PrintingAcc

android - AccountManager - authToken 已设置但 peekAuthToken 返回 null

我正在尝试添加一个新帐户(在Facebook登录+服务器之后验证)在AccountManager中。这个案例的流程是这样的:用户使用Facebook登录我在登录完成后获得了详细信息,并根据我服务器上的数据对其进行了验证如果一切正常,服务器返回一个auth_token(JWTtoken)有了用户的详细信息和auth_token我正在通过AccountManager创建一个帐户,一旦创建,我就设置了authToken下次登录时,当用户重新打开应用程序时,我调用getAuthToken,它首先尝试通过调用peekAuthToken()获取缓存的authToken。问题在第5点,peekAut

[开源工具]Firefox 检测到潜在的安全威胁,并因 accounts.firefox.com 要求安全连接...

Firefox检测到潜在的安全威胁,并因accounts.firefox.com要求安全连接...解决方案:1.在火狐地址栏中输入,about:config,打开后将以下4个布尔值设为false2.如果1不好使,继续设置security.enterprise_roots.enabled为true3.如果2也不好使,请继续打开firefox的设置解决方案:1.在火狐地址栏中输入,about:config,打开后将以下4个布尔值设为falsesecurity.SSL3.dhe_DSS_AES_128_shasecurity.SSL3.dhe_RSA_AES_128_shasecurity.SSL3

android - 客户经理 : Android App not appearing under Accounts Tab of Settings,

我正在尝试将我的应用程序添加到设置的“帐户部分”。这样当用户点击Addaccount时,我的应用程序名称是可见的。完整代码可见here我创建了一个身份验证器服务。这就是我的list的样子我还创建了一个“authenticator.xml”但我仍然没有在帐户下看到我的应用程序。我正在关注thistutorial但它不工作。你能告诉我我做错了什么吗? 最佳答案 在标签中使用资源字符串而不是文字文本。“authenticator.xml”android:label="@string/some_label"

android - 如何找到与 Android 电子市场关联的 Gmail 帐户?

我知道如何查找帐户(其中包括用户的gmail电子邮件ID)以及如何过滤gmail帐户。AccountManageram=AccountManager.get(context);Account[]accounts=am.getAccounts();ArrayListgoogleAccounts=newArrayList();for(Accountac:accounts){Stringacname=ac.name;Stringactype=ac.type;//addonlygoogleaccountsif(ac.type.equals("com.google")){googleAccoun

Android - 如何创建 Intent 以打开显示 "Accounts & Sync settings"屏幕的 Activity

我在导航到“帐户和同步设置”屏幕时看到了以下日志消息,但我对如何创建Intent以导航到那里感到困惑。INFO/ActivityManager(53):Startingactivity:Intent{cmp=com.android.providers.subscribedfeeds/com.android.settings.ManageAccountsSettings}我似乎无权访问用于开发的ManageAccountsSettings。我只是想创建一个如下所示的Intent,但我无法调出ManageAccountsSettingsIntenti=newIntent(this,Mana

android - Google Drive REST API 是否仍需要 GET_ACCOUNTS 权限?

Google已弃用GoogleDriveAndroidAPI。我们正在迁移到GoogleDriveRESTAPI(v3)。2年前,我们有使用GoogleDriveRESTAPI(v2)的经验。我们知道GET_ACCOUNTS权限是必需的,GoogleAuthUtil.getToken()才能正常工作-GoogleDriveAPI-thenamemustnotbeempty:null(ButIhadpassedvalidaccountnametoGoogleAccountCredential)当我们查看GoogleDriveRESTAPI(v3)示例时-https://github.co

android - 未经 GET_ACCOUNTS 许可从 GoogleApiClient 获取 Google 帐户 token

这是从Google+登录中使用的GoogleApiClient获取token的传统方式:Stringtoken=GoogleAuthUtil.getToken(apiClient.getContext(),getAccountNameFromGoogle(apiClient),SCOPE);但是,GetAccountNameFromGoogle方法需要android.permission.GET_ACCOUNTS权限,在AndroidMDeveloperPreview3中,此权限现在被标记为危险并分组到联系人组中。这意味着如果有人想登录我的应用程序,他需要授予我的应用程序完整的联系人权